^ Thanks!
It's very similar to intermittent fasting which many athletes do. However, it's not only about not eating or drinking from sun up until sun down. It's so much more than that.
You're supposed to refrain from any sexual physical stuff, you can't smoke or put anything into your body. Giving to charity and devoting your time to the worship of God is key. That's the true intention of this month.
